How MIPS and board certification work

The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us continuous Maintenance of Certification cycles. Verify any individual provider's status through certificationmatters.org (ABMS) or osteopathic.org (AOA).

Thalia Tucci, PMHNP-BC appears in the CMS NPPES registry as a Psychiatric/Mental Health Nurse Practitioner provider holding PMHNP-BC credentials at 6300 N REVERE DR STE 255, Kansas City, MO, 64151, with a listed phone of (816) 744-6145. NPI 1760929152 was issued on 01/24/2017.

Medicare Part D records for calendar year 2023 show 113 prescription claims written by this provider, covering 21 Medicare beneficiaries and totaling roughly $2K in drug spend. On the CMS Merit-based Incentive Payment System, this provider earned a Final Score of 94.9/100 for the 2023 performance year (Quality 87.8), compared with the 83.5 average among clinicians with a measured score.

Psychiatric/Mental Health Nurse Practitioner is a mid-sized specialty nationwide, with 40,776 enrolled providers across 54 states and an average of 927 Part D claims per prescriber, so the context for interpreting these metrics differs meaningfully from a primary-care baseline.

Limitations
Provider data is self-reported to CMS. Prescribing data reflects Medicare Part D only and does not include commercial insurance, Medicaid, or cash prescriptions. Claims below 11 beneficiaries are suppressed by CMS for privacy.
